    Ward UD.

    Dirrell can't (or won't) fight on the inside and doesn't like it rough and I feel that's exactly how Ward will approach the fight. Get inside and rough him up and bully Dirrell. I think that Dirrell loses focus slightly or can get knocked off his game when roughed up which would play into Ward's hands. Ward has the tools (speed, skills, athleticism) and the smarts to get it on the inside or indeed take the fight wherever he wants it, unlike Froch and Abraham, who ended up chasing Dirrell and being picked off.
